Cemetery fence installation services involve the careful planning and placement of fencing around burial grounds to establish a respectful and defined boundary. Professionals typically assess the property to determine the appropriate fencing materials, height, and style that align with the cemetery’s aesthetic and functional needs. The process may include site preparation, such as clearing or leveling the ground, followed by the installation of posts, panels, and gates to create a secure enclosure. These services aim to provide a dignified perimeter that enhances the overall appearance of the cemetery while ensuring durability and longevity.
One of the primary issues cemetery fence installation helps address is the need for security and protection of the site. Fences act as a barrier to prevent unauthorized access, vandalism, or accidental intrusion, helping to preserve the sanctity of the burial area. Additionally, fencing can serve as a visual boundary that clearly marks the property limits, reducing potential disputes or confusion about ownership. Properly installed fences also assist in maintaining the site’s appearance, preventing encroachment by weeds or debris, and providing a clear, respectful boundary for visitors and mourners.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for cemetery fence installation can range from approximately $20 to $50 per linear foot, depending on the type of fencing chosen, such as wrought iron or vinyl. Higher-end materials like ornate iron may incre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ific material selections.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a cemetery fence typically fall between $15 and $40 per linear foot. The total labor charge depends on the fence height, design complexity, and site conditions. Exact prices vary by contractor and project scope.
Permitting and Fees - Permitting fees for cemetery fence installation generally range from $50 to $200, depending on local regulations in Harrison, OH. Additional costs may include site preparation or inspection fees, which can influence the overall budget. Pros can advise on required permits and associated costs.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for cemetery fence installation usually range from $2,000 to $8,000 for typical residential plots, but can vary based on size, material, and design choices. Larger or more elaborate fences will naturally increase the total expense. Local service providers can offer tailored cost estimates for specific proj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
